What Is Resilient Flooring and How It Affects Your Facility

Resilient flooring offers comfort and flexibility for your business and its flooring. They’re typically found in healthcare, educational, and other high-traffic buildings. They’re made of a polymer, often designed into vinyl tile, cork, rubber flooring, and other types of soft flooring.
